Transaction ffdba8951ea404099ab1f29ceca95549624768d94e4dee686921cd5a780c3c4c
1 Input
1 Output
-
ffdba8951ea404099ab1f29ceca95549624768d94e4dee686921cd5a780c3c4c:0
- value
- 21702685
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c54e8b123d4894d15a23dfa43610f501c6f487ed052f5a98d0b78ba11c81563c
- address
- bc1pc48gky3afz2dzk3rm7jrvy84q8r0fpldq5h44xxsk796z8yp2c7qsn5efr